VCK Functionary Vikraman Refutes Allegations Of Sexual Assault, His Wife Says Viral Video Is Related To Film Shoot

A video went viral on social media, allegedly showing Vikraman, a Viduthalai Chiruthaigal Katchi executive and former contestant of Bigg Boss Tamil 6, dressed as a woman and sexually harassing a young man. However, Vikraman has refuted these claims, stating that the video was taken during the shooting of a movie and has been misrepresented to defame him.

The controversy erupted after the video surfaced online, with users alleging that Vikraman was caught red-handed engaging in inappropriate behavior. The claims gained further traction when reports surfaced that director Rajumurugan’s wife had filed a complaint regarding illegal activities in the apartment complex where Vikraman was residing. These rumors linked Vikraman to the alleged activities and accused him of wrongdoing.

In response to the accusations, Vikraman issued a statement on the social media platform X, asserting that he would pursue strict legal action against those spreading baseless allegations. He clarified that the video was part of a film shoot and had been taken out of context to malign his reputation. He wrote, Strict legal action will be taken against those who spread defamation without any basis based on something that happened during a movie shoot. My heartfelt thanks to the management of Polymer Television for acting ethically and taking prompt action.”

Despite his explanation, social media discussions continued, with some individuals insisting that Vikraman was involved in a case where a 23-year-old youth was allegedly injured. Others suggested that Vikraman attempted to suppress the video by threatening those who recorded it and allegedly offering a large sum of money to destroy it.

Amid the growing controversy, Vikraman’s supporters urged him to release an official statement from the film’s production team, clarifying the context of the video. They emphasized that doing so would help counter the misinformation and clear his name.

Further, Vikraman’s wife has reportedly filed a complaint at the Tiruvekkadu police station, seeking legal action against those who have misrepresented the video and spread false allegations. She said that the video is related to a film shoot that she and her husband were working on.

We had to film a video related to a shooting in the old house we lived in. It was taken for shooting purpose when I was away from town. That video has been mischaracterized and somebody has spread it to defame.”, she said.

When a reporter asked about the viral video having no camera or characteristics of a film shoot Vikraman’s wife said “I didn’t say it was a shoot. I said it’s a video related to shoot. It’s not a film shoot. We tried to do a test video for a shoot. That time I was in Madurai. So, I asked him (Vikraman) to shoot the video himself and send.”
